The first time I saw Devyn and Logan together, the word that came to mind was LOVEBIRDS.  

I was so excited to get the opportunity to assist Devyn with their wedding plans...and I knew I'd have to include some porcelain lovebirds into the decor.

She and Logan had decided early on they wanted an understated celebration and with her parents' home located in the farming community, decided it'd provide the perfect backdrop.

Devyn was deep in school finals, but insisted on some DIY projects to inject some home-grown flair into the decor...I just adore how the photo blocks and mason jar lanterns created awesome focal points around the yard!  She gave carte blanche to almost everything else, and was thrilled with how everything came together to create a fun palette of royal blue and hunter green with energetic splashes of berry thrown in.

At the end of the day, everyone was thrilled...They are truly happy together and the love and respect they showed to one another was (and still is) an inspiration to other couples heading down the aisle!...such sweet, sugary lovebirds!
